PF07350 Gig2-like family

This family includes Gig2 from Candida albicans, YbiU from Escherichia coli and uncharacterised proteins predominantly found in fungi and bacteria. Gig2 is a putative oxidoreductase thought to play a role in the undefined GlcNAc metabolic network. It folds into a single large domain with a cupin like double stranded beta-helix core surrounded by 20 alpha-helices. This protein shows similarity with 2- oxoglutarate dependant Fe containing oxygenases [1].
